Hi All,
I'm a long time lurker, first time poster...
My breakdown is as follows:
Have been working in the south for 8 months now with job progressing well, I earn 36K, and in addition have a company pension at 4% gross income, which company matches.
I have rental outgoings of 400 pcm and household builds circa 100pcm so a total necessary outgoing of 500 pcm.
I have therefore roughly 2K per month to play around with, ideally I would like to get something away now for medium - long term i.e. 10 years plus as I have land back in the north which when settling down will be available to build on and would like to be in a strong position to do so without taking out a large mortgage.
I would ideally like to use the tax free investment vehicles such as ISAs to but haven't seen anything on the site to point in that direction (possibly looking in wrong area?) but basically any advice would be welcome as stated I am a complete novice and would appreciate any views as how I could make my money work best for me?
